CNC Machining
Complex Components, Consistent Results
Our CNC machining services are built for components that require tight control and dependable performance.
Capabilities include:
- Multi-axis CNC milling for complex geometries
- CNC turning for rotational parts
- Close-tolerance machining for critical fits
- Aluminum, stainless steel, titanium, and engineering-grade plastics
From one-off parts to scaled production, we deliver reliable, repeatable manufacturing outcomes.
